A Firefox 59.0.3 kijavítja a Windows 2018. április 10-i kompatibilitási problémáját

Firefox felhasználók, akik a webböngésző stabil verzióját futtatják és tervezik a frissítést a 2018. április A Windows 10 frissített verziója az elkövetkező napokban érdemes lehet megbizonyosodnia arról, hogy a webböngésző frissítve van-e az 59.0.3 verzióra, hogy elkerülje a kompatibilitási problémákat.

A Microsoft tervezi közzétenni az új letöltési linkeit és letöltési lehetőségeit a Windows 10 szolgáltatás frissítése ma. Valójában néhány hivatkozás már működik, és a felhasználók letölthetik az ISO képeket, hogy az operációs rendszer legfrissebb frissítését telepítsék a célgépekre.



Míg a Firefox a Windows 2018. április 10-i frissítést futtató gépeken fut, a felhasználóknak kompatibilitási problémákba ütközhetnek azokon a webhelyeken, amelyeket a böngészőben nyitnak meg a Windows 10 1803 verziójának futtatásakor.

Szerint egy hibajelentéshez a Mozilla hibakereső webhelyén, a Bugzilla webhelyen, ahol a meghatározott kódot használó webhelyek az „érvénytelen reguláris kifejezés zászlója” hibaüzenetet jelenítik meg. Egy másik oldal „halálos hibát” okozott a terhelésnél. A hibákat csak akkor kell eltávolítani, ha a Firefox 59.0.2 vagy korábbi verziója fut a Windows 10 1803-as verziójú rendszerein.

firefox error

A Firefox nem érinti a Windows korábbi verzióit. A probléma csak a Firefox, a Stable, az ESR és a Fejlesztői kiadást érinti, és más böngészőket, például a Chrome-ot vagy az Edge-t nem érinti Brian Duke szerint, aki a problémát jelentette a Mozilla-nak.



Megpróbáltam megismételni a problémát a Pale Moon-ban, és a hibát nem dobták el egy Windows 10 1803-as verziószámú gépen.

David Major felfedezte, hogy miért dob ​​a Firefox a Windows 10380-as verziójában hibákat, míg a Firefox ugyanazon verziója a régebbi verzióknál nem.

A regexp zászlók itt elemzésekor: https://searchfox.org/mozilla-central/rev/7ccb618f45a1398e31a086a009f87c8fd3a790b6/js/src/frontend/TokenStream.cpp#2002

A „g” után az EOF-et az ucrtbase! Isalpha-n keresztül küldjük el (a JS7_ISLET-en keresztül: https://searchfox.org/mozilla-central/rev/7ccb618f45a1398e31a086a009f87c8fd3a790b6/js/src/util/Text.h#39)

Az 17133.1 alatt az ucrtbase! Isalpha (-1) true értéket ad vissza (legalábbis angol nyelven), és eldobja az értelmező logikáját. 16299 alatt az ucrtbase! Isalpha (-1) hamis volt.

Nem világos, milyen széles körű a kérdés, de elég fontosnak tűnik, hogy a Mozilla rövid időn belül kiadja a Firefox Stable és a Firefox ESR frissítését, a Firefox következő fő verziójának (Firefox 60 és Firefox 60 ESR) kiadása előtt.

firefox 59.0.3

A Mozilla a Firefox új verziójának bevezetését tervezi ma a böngésző frissítő csatornáin keresztül. Amikor a Firefox-ot most letölti a stub telepítő segítségével a Mozilla webhelyéről, akkor már megkapja az 59.0.3 új verziót, amelynek a probléma javítva van.



A frissítés ellenőrzéséhez válassza a Súgó> Menü> A Firefox névjegye menüpontot a böngészőben. Nézze meg a kiadási megjegyzéseket itt.